Initial Training Overview:
Job training for this MOS consists of nine weeks of Basic Training, plus nine weeks of Advanced Individual Training (AIT) at Sheppard Air Force Base in Texas.

Training Details:
Includes instruction in installation, operation and maintenance of electrical power distribution systems including pole top rescue, substation maintenance, installing poles accessories and transformers, maintenance on lines, use of hot line equipment, service drops, area and street lighting, airfield lighting systems, overhead and underground lines including replacing splicing and termination; emphasis on the use of technical and manufacturer publications, as applicable, to electric power line distribution.
